Čeština

Prozkoumejte Data Mesh, decentralizovaný přístup k datové architektuře, jeho principy, výhody, výzvy a praktické implementační strategie pro organizace po celém světě.

Data Mesh: Decentralizovaný architektonický přístup pro moderní správu dat

V dnešním rychle se vyvíjejícím datovém prostředí se organizace potýkají s výzvami správy obrovského množství dat generovaných z různých zdrojů. Tradiční centralizované datové architektury, jako jsou datové sklady a datová jezera, se často snaží držet krok s rostoucími požadavky na agilitu, škálovatelnost a doménově specifické poznatky. Zde se Data Mesh objevuje jako přesvědčivá alternativa, která nabízí decentralizovaný přístup k vlastnictví, správě a přístupu k datům.

Co je Data Mesh?

Data Mesh je decentralizovaná datová architektura, která zahrnuje doménově orientovaný, samoobslužný přístup ke správě dat. Posouvá zaměření z centralizovaného datového týmu a infrastruktury na posílení jednotlivých obchodních domén, aby vlastnily a spravovaly svá data jako produkty. Cílem tohoto přístupu je řešit úzká hrdla a nepružnost často spojené s tradičními centralizovanými datovými architekturami.

Základní myšlenkou Data Mesh je považovat data za produkt, přičemž každá doména odpovídá za kvalitu, zjistitelnost, dostupnost a bezpečnost svých vlastních datových aktiv. Tento decentralizovaný přístup umožňuje rychlejší inovace, větší agilitu a lepší datovou gramotnost v celé organizaci.

Čtyři principy Data Mesh

Data Mesh se řídí čtyřmi klíčovými principy:

1. Doménově orientované decentralizované vlastnictví a architektura dat

Tento princip zdůrazňuje, že vlastnictví dat by mělo spočívat v obchodních doménách, které data generují a spotřebovávají. Každá doména odpovídá za správu svých vlastních datových pipeline, datového úložiště a datových produktů, přičemž postupy správy dat jsou v souladu s obchodními potřebami. Tato decentralizace umožňuje doménám rychleji reagovat na měnící se obchodní požadavky a podporuje inovace v rámci jejich příslušných oblastí.

Příklad: Ve velké organizaci elektronického obchodu vlastní doména 'Zákazník' všechna data související se zákazníky, včetně demografických údajů, historie nákupů a metrik zapojení. Jsou zodpovědní za vytváření a údržbu datových produktů, které poskytují přehled o chování a preferencích zákazníků.

2. Data jako produkt

S daty se zachází jako s produktem s jasným pochopením jeho spotřebitelů, kvality a hodnotové nabídky. Každá doména odpovídá za to, aby byla její data zjistitelná, přístupná, srozumitelná, důvěryhodná a interoperabilní. To zahrnuje definování datových smluv, poskytování jasné dokumentace a zajištění kvality dat prostřednictvím přísného testování a monitorování.

Příklad: Doména 'Sklad' v maloobchodní společnosti by mohla vytvořit datový produkt, který poskytuje úrovně zásob v reálném čase pro každý produkt. Tento datový produkt by byl přístupný jiným doménám, jako jsou 'Prodej' a 'Marketing', prostřednictvím dobře definovaného API.

3. Samoobslužná datová infrastruktura jako platforma

Samoobslužná datová infrastrukturní platforma poskytuje základní nástroje a služby, které domény potřebují k budování, nasazování a správě svých datových produktů. Tato platforma by měla nabízet funkce, jako je ingestování dat, transformace dat, ukládání dat, správa dat a zabezpečení dat, vše samoobslužným způsobem. Platforma by měla abstrahovat složitosti základní infrastruktury a umožnit doménám soustředit se na vytváření hodnoty z jejich dat.

Příklad: Cloudová datová platforma, jako je AWS, Azure nebo Google Cloud, může poskytnout samoobslužnou datovou infrastrukturu se službami, jako jsou datová jezera, datové sklady, datové pipeline a nástroje pro správu dat.

4. Federovaná výpočetní správa

Zatímco Data Mesh podporuje decentralizaci, také uznává potřebu určité úrovně centralizované správy k zajištění interoperability, bezpečnosti a shody. Federovaná výpočetní správa zahrnuje zavedení souboru společných standardů, zásad a pokynů, které musí dodržovat všechny domény. Tyto zásady jsou vymáhány prostřednictvím automatizovaných mechanismů, které zajišťují konzistenci a shodu v celé organizaci.

Příklad: Globální finanční instituce by mohla zavést zásady ochrany osobních údajů, které vyžadují, aby všechny domény dodržovaly nařízení GDPR při manipulaci s údaji o zákaznících ze zemí Evropské unie. Tyto zásady by byly vymáhány prostřednictvím automatizovaných technik maskování a šifrování dat.

Výhody Data Mesh

Implementace Data Mesh nabízí organizacím několik významných výhod:

Výzvy Data Mesh

Zatímco Data Mesh nabízí řadu výhod, představuje také některé výzvy, které musí organizace řešit:

Implementace Data Mesh: Průvodce krok za krokem

Implementace Data Mesh je složitý úkol, který vyžaduje pečlivé plánování a provedení. Zde je průvodce krok za krokem, který organizacím pomůže začít:

1. Posuďte připravenost vaší organizace

Před zahájením implementace Data Mesh je důležité posoudit připravenost vaší organizace. Zvažte následující faktory:

2. Identifikujte své obchodní domény

Prvním krokem při implementaci Data Mesh je identifikovat obchodní domény, které budou vlastnit a spravovat svá data. Tyto domény by měly být v souladu s obchodními jednotkami nebo funkčními oblastmi organizace. Zvažte domény, jako jsou:

3. Definujte datové produkty

Pro každou doménu definujte datové produkty, za jejichž vytváření a údržbu budou zodpovědné. Datové produkty by měly být v souladu s obchodními cíli domény a měly by poskytovat hodnotu jiným doménám. Příklady datových produktů zahrnují:

4. Vybudujte samoobslužnou datovou infrastrukturní platformu

Dalším krokem je vybudování samoobslužné datové infrastrukturní platformy, která poskytuje nástroje a služby, které domény potřebují k budování, nasazování a správě svých datových produktů. Tato platforma by měla zahrnovat funkce, jako jsou:

5. Zaveďte federovanou výpočetní správu

Zaveďte soubor společných standardů, zásad a pokynů, které musí dodržovat všechny domény. Tyto zásady by se měly zabývat oblastmi, jako je kvalita dat, zabezpečení, shoda a interoperabilita. Vymáhejte tyto zásady prostřednictvím automatizovaných mechanismů, abyste zajistili konzistenci a shodu v celé organizaci.

Příklad: Implementace sledování původu dat k zajištění kvality dat a sledovatelnosti napříč různými doménami.

6. Školte a zmocňujte týmy domén

Poskytněte týmům domén školení a zdroje, které potřebují ke správě svých vlastních dat. To zahrnuje školení o osvědčených postupech správy dat, zásadách správy dat a používání samoobslužné datové infrastrukturní platformy. Umožněte týmům domén experimentovat s jejich daty a vytvářet inovativní datové produkty.

7. Monitorujte a opakujte

Nepřetržitě monitorujte výkon Data Mesh a opakujte implementaci na základě zpětné vazby a získaných poznatků. Sledujte klíčové metriky, jako je kvalita dat, rychlost přístupu k datům a spokojenost domény. Podle potřeby proveďte úpravy samoobslužné datové infrastrukturní platformy a zásad správy.

Případy použití Data Mesh

Data Mesh lze použít v široké řadě případů použití napříč různými odvětvími. Zde je několik příkladů:

Příklad: Globální telekomunikační společnost používá Data Mesh k analýze vzorců používání zákazníků a personalizaci nabídek služeb, což vede ke zvýšení spokojenosti zákazníků a snížení odlivu zákazníků.

Data Mesh vs. Data Lake

Data Mesh je často srovnávána s datovými jezery, další populární datovou architekturou. Zatímco oba přístupy se snaží demokratizovat přístup k datům, liší se svými základními principy a implementací. Zde je srovnání obou:

Funkce Data Lake Data Mesh
Vlastnictví dat Centralizované Decentralizované
Správa dat Centralizovaná Federovaná
Správa dat Centralizovaná Decentralizovaná
Data jako produkt Není primárním zaměřením Základní princip
Struktura týmu Centralizovaný datový tým Týmy sladěné s doménou

Stručně řečeno, Data Mesh je decentralizovaný přístup, který umožňuje týmům domén vlastnit a spravovat svá data, zatímco datová jezera jsou obvykle centralizovaná a spravovaná jedním datovým týmem.

Budoucnost Data Mesh

Data Mesh je rychle se vyvíjející architektonický přístup, který si získává stále větší oblibu mezi organizacemi po celém světě. Jak objemy dat neustále rostou a obchodní potřeby se stávají složitějšími, Data Mesh se pravděpodobně stane ještě důležitějším nástrojem pro správu a demokratizaci přístupu k datům. Budoucí trendy v Data Mesh zahrnují:

Závěr

Data Mesh představuje posun paradigmatu v datové architektuře a nabízí decentralizovaný a doménově orientovaný přístup ke správě dat. Tím, že umožňuje obchodním doménám vlastnit a spravovat svá data jako produkty, umožňuje Data Mesh organizacím dosáhnout větší agility, škálovatelnosti a inovací. Zatímco implementace Data Mesh představuje některé výzvy, výhody tohoto přístupu jsou významné pro organizace, které chtějí uvolnit plný potenciál svých dat.

Vzhledem k tomu, že se organizace po celém světě i nadále potýkají se složitostí moderní správy dat, Data Mesh nabízí slibnou cestu vpřed, která jim umožňuje využít sílu dat k dosažení obchodního úspěchu. Tento decentralizovaný přístup podporuje kulturu řízenou daty a umožňuje týmům přijímat informovaná rozhodnutí na základě spolehlivých, přístupných a doménově relevantních dat.

V konečném důsledku závisí úspěch implementace Data Mesh na silném závazku k organizačním změnám, jasném pochopení obchodních potřeb a ochotě investovat do nezbytných nástrojů a dovedností. Přijetím principů Data Mesh mohou organizace uvolnit skutečnou hodnotu svých dat a získat konkurenční výhodu v dnešním světě řízeném daty.